Best Health Gadgets for 2025 Smartwatches/Fitness Trackers – Like Apple Watch or Fitbit: Track steps, heart rate, calories burned, and workouts. Smart Scales – Measure weight, body fat, muscle mass, and sync to apps for progress charts. Sleep Trackers – Devices like Oura Ring monitor sleep stages and recovery. Blood Pressure Monitors – Home devices for regular checks, especially useful for health management. Smart Water Bottles – Remind you to stay hydrated. Bodyweight exercises use your own weight as resistance, making them accessible and safe for beginners to advanced fitness levels. They're great for weight loss, muscle toning, and boosting metabolism—all from the comfort of your living room.
